# distutils: language = c++
|
|
# cython: language_level = 3
|
|
import builtins
|
|
import datetime
|
|
import json
|
|
from libcpp cimport bool
|
|
from libcpp.string cimport string
|
|
from libcpp.vector cimport vector
|
|
from libcpp.optional cimport optional
|
|
|
|
from openpilot.common.swaglog import cloudlog
|
|
|
|
cdef extern from "common/params.h":
|
|
cpdef enum ParamKeyFlag:
|
|
PERSISTENT
|
|
CLEAR_ON_MANAGER_START
|
|
CLEAR_ON_ONROAD_TRANSITION
|
|
CLEAR_ON_OFFROAD_TRANSITION
|
|
DEVELOPMENT_ONLY
|
|
CLEAR_ON_IGNITION_ON
|
|
ALL
|
|
|
|
cpdef enum ParamKeyType:
|
|
STRING
|
|
BOOL
|
|
INT
|
|
FLOAT
|
|
TIME
|
|
JSON
|
|
BYTES
|
|
|
|
cdef cppclass c_Params "Params":
|
|
c_Params(string) except + nogil
|
|
string get(string, bool) nogil
|
|
bool getBool(string, bool) nogil
|
|
int remove(string) nogil
|
|
int put(string, string) nogil
|
|
void putNonBlocking(string, string) nogil
|
|
void putBoolNonBlocking(string, bool) nogil
|
|
int putBool(string, bool) nogil
|
|
bool checkKey(string) nogil
|
|
ParamKeyType getKeyType(string) nogil
|
|
optional[string] getKeyDefaultValue(string) nogil
|
|
string getParamPath(string) nogil
|
|
void clearAll(ParamKeyFlag)
|
|
vector[string] allKeys()
|
|
|
|
PYTHON_2_CPP = {
|
|
(str, STRING): lambda v: v,
|
|
(builtins.bool, BOOL): lambda v: "1" if v else "0",
|
|
(int, INT): str,
|
|
(float, FLOAT): str,
|
|
(datetime.datetime, TIME): lambda v: v.isoformat(),
|
|
(dict, JSON): json.dumps,
|
|
(list, JSON): json.dumps,
|
|
(bytes, BYTES): lambda v: v,
|
|
}
|
|
CPP_2_PYTHON = {
|
|
STRING: lambda v: v.decode("utf-8"),
|
|
BOOL: lambda v: v == b"1",
|
|
INT: int,
|
|
FLOAT: float,
|
|
TIME: lambda v: datetime.datetime.fromisoformat(v.decode("utf-8")),
|
|
JSON: json.loads,
|
|
BYTES: lambda v: v,
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
def ensure_bytes(v):
|
|
return v.encode() if isinstance(v, str) else v
|
|
|
|
class UnknownKeyName(Exception):
|
|
pass
|
|
|
|
cdef class Params:
|
|
cdef c_Params* p
|
|
cdef str d
|
|
|
|
def __cinit__(self, d=""):
|
|
cdef string path = <string>d.encode()
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
self.p = new c_Params(path)
|
|
self.d = d
|
|
|
|
def __reduce__(self):
|
|
return (type(self), (self.d,))
|
|
|
|
def __dealloc__(self):
|
|
del self.p
|
|
|
|
def clear_all(self, tx_flag=ParamKeyFlag.ALL):
|
|
self.p.clearAll(tx_flag)
|
|
|
|
def check_key(self, key):
|
|
key = ensure_bytes(key)
|
|
if not self.p.checkKey(key):
|
|
raise UnknownKeyName(key)
|
|
return key
|
|
|
|
def python2cpp(self, proposed_type, expected_type, value, key):
|
|
cast = PYTHON_2_CPP.get((proposed_type, expected_type))
|
|
if cast:
|
|
return cast(value)
|
|
raise TypeError(f"Type mismatch while writing param {key}: {proposed_type=} {expected_type=} {value=}")
|
|
|
|
def cpp2python(self, t, value, default, key):
|
|
if value is None:
|
|
return None
|
|
try:
|
|
return CPP_2_PYTHON[t](value)
|
|
except (KeyError, TypeError, ValueError):
|
|
cloudlog.warning(f"Failed to cast param {key} with {value=} from type {t=}")
|
|
return self.cpp2python(t, default, None, key)
|
|
|
|
def get(self, key, bool block=False, bool return_default=False):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
cdef ParamKeyType t = self.p.getKeyType(k)
|
|
cdef optional[string] default = self.p.getKeyDefaultValue(k)
|
|
cdef string val
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
val = self.p.get(k, block)
|
|
|
|
default_val = (default.value() if default.has_value() else None) if return_default else None
|
|
if val == b"":
|
|
if block:
|
|
# If we got no value while running in blocked mode
|
|
# it means we got an interrupt while waiting
|
|
raise KeyboardInterrupt
|
|
else:
|
|
return self.cpp2python(t, default_val, None, key)
|
|
return self.cpp2python(t, val, default_val, key)
|
|
|
|
def get_bool(self, key, bool block=False):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
cdef bool r
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
r = self.p.getBool(k, block)
|
|
return r
|
|
|
|
def _put_cast(self, key, dat):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
cdef ParamKeyType t = self.p.getKeyType(k)
|
|
return ensure_bytes(self.python2cpp(type(dat), t, dat, key))
|
|
|
|
def put(self, key, dat):
|
|
"""
|
|
Warning: This function blocks until the param is written to disk!
|
|
In very rare cases this can take over a second, and your code will hang.
|
|
Use the put_nonblocking, put_bool_nonblocking in time sensitive code, but
|
|
in general try to avoid writing params as much as possible.
|
|
"""
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
cdef string dat_bytes = self._put_cast(key, dat)
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
self.p.put(k, dat_bytes)
|
|
|
|
def put_bool(self, key, bool val):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
self.p.putBool(k, val)
|
|
|
|
def put_nonblocking(self, key, dat):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
cdef string dat_bytes = self._put_cast(key, dat)
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
self.p.putNonBlocking(k, dat_bytes)
|
|
|
|
def put_bool_nonblocking(self, key, bool val):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
self.p.putBoolNonBlocking(k, val)
|
|
|
|
def remove(self, key):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
with nogil:
|
|
self.p.remove(k)
|
|
|
|
def get_param_path(self, key=""):
|
|
cdef string key_bytes = ensure_bytes(key)
|
|
return self.p.getParamPath(key_bytes).decode("utf-8")
|
|
|
|
def get_type(self, key):
|
|
return self.p.getKeyType(self.check_key(key))
|
|
|
|
def all_keys(self):
|
|
return self.p.allKeys()
|
|
|
|
def get_default_value(self, key):
|
|
cdef string k = self.check_key(key)
|
|
cdef ParamKeyType t = self.p.getKeyType(k)
|
|
cdef optional[string] default = self.p.getKeyDefaultValue(k)
|
|
return self.cpp2python(t, default.value(), None, key) if default.has_value() else None
